컴퓨터 백엔드 스킬 강화하기

HTML5 CONCEPT컴퓨터 백엔드 스킬 강화하기


컴퓨터 백엔드 스킬 강화하기

컴퓨터 백엔드 스킬 강화하기

컴퓨터 백엔드는 소프트웨어 애플리케이션의 핵심 부분을 담당하는 중요한 역할을 합니다. 백엔드 개발자는 데이터베이스, 서버, 애플리케이션 로직 등을 다루며 사용자가 보이지 않는 부분을 관리하고 있습니다. 이러한 이유로 컴퓨터 백엔드 스킬을 강화하는 것은 매우 중요합니다.

컴퓨터 백엔드 스킬을 강화하기 위해서는 다양한 기술과 도구에 대한 이해와 숙련이 필요합니다. 프로그래밍 언어에 대한 깊은 이해와 데이터베이스 관리, 네트워크 프로토콜, 보안 등 다양한 영역에 대한 지식이 요구됩니다. 또한 최신 트렌드를 따라가며 새로운 기술을 배우고 적용하는 능력도 중요합니다.


  • 데이터베이스 관리
  • 네트워크 보안
  • 클라우드 컴퓨팅
  • 시스템 아키텍처

데이터베이스 관리

데이터베이스 관리는 기업이나 조직이 보유하고 있는 데이터를 효율적으로 관리하고 활용하기 위한 중요한 작업입니다. 데이터베이스 관리는 데이터의 수집, 저장, 검색, 분석, 백업 및 보안을 포함하며, 이를 통해 조직은 중요한 비즈니스 결정을 내리는 데 도움을 받을 수 있습니다.

데이터베이스 관리는 데이터의 일관성, 정확성, 보안성을 유지하고 데이터의 무결성을 보장하는 역할을 합니다. 이를 통해 조직은 신속하고 정확한 정보에 접근할 수 있으며, 이를 통해 경쟁우위를 확보할 수 있습니다.

데이터베이스 관리는 데이터베이스 시스템을 설계, 구축, 유지보수하는 것을 의미하며, 이를 위해 데이터베이스 관리 시스템(DBMS)을 활용합니다. DBMS는 데이터베이스를 관리하고 조작하는 소프트웨어로, 데이터베이스의 구조화, 저장, 검색, 업데이트, 삭제 등을 처리합니다.

데이터베이스 관리는 데이터의 가치를 최대화하고 조직의 성과를 향상시키는 데 중요한 역할을 합니다. 따라서 조직은 데이터베이스 관리에 충분한 리소스를 투자하고 전문가들을 고용하여 데이터를 효율적으로 관리해야 합니다.

네트워크 보안

네트워크 보안은 현대 사회에서 매우 중요한 주제로 자리 잡았습니다. 인터넷과 모바일 기기의 보급으로 인해 사이버 공격이 증가하고 있기 때문에, 기업이나 개인이 네트워크 보안에 신경을 써야 합니다. 네트워크 보안은 기밀성, 무결성, 가용성을 보장하기 위해 다양한 방법과 기술을 사용합니다. 방화벽, 침입 탐지 시스템, 가상 사설망 등의 보안 시스템을 구축하여 외부로부터의 공격을 막을 수 있습니다.

또한, 내부에서의 보안 위협에도 대비해야 합니다. 직원들의 실수나 악의적인 행동으로 인해 기밀 정보가 유출될 수 있기 때문에, 접근 제어와 사용 권한 관리가 중요합니다. 또한, 주기적인 보안 감사와 교육을 통해 직원들이 보안 정책을 숙지하고 준수할 수 있도록 해야 합니다.

네트워크 보안은 끝없는 전쟁이며, 공격자들은 항상 새로운 방법을 개발하고 있습니다. 따라서 기업이나 개인은 보안 시스템을 지속적으로 업데이트하고 모니터링해야 합니다. 또한, 보안 사고가 발생했을 때 신속하고 효과적으로 대응할 수 있는 대응 계획을 마련해 두어야 합니다. 네트워크 보안은 모든 기업과 개인에게 필수적인 요소이며, 미리 대비하는 것이 중요합니다.

클라우드 컴퓨팅

클라우드 컴퓨팅은 현대 기술의 중심에 있는 중요한 개념 중 하나입니다. 클라우드 컴퓨팅은 인터넷을 통해 데이터를 저장, 관리 및 처리하는 기술을 말합니다. 이 기술은 기업이나 개인이 데이터를 저장하고 액세스할 수 있는 유연성과 편의성을 제공합니다. 또한 클라우드 컴퓨팅은 더 나은 보안 및 데이터 관리를 가능하게 해줍니다.

클라우드 컴퓨팅은 기업이나 조직이 IT 인프라를 구축하고 유지하는 비용을 절감할 수 있도록 도와줍니다. 또한 클라우드 컴퓨팅은 확장성이 뛰어나기 때문에 필요에 따라 리소스를 증가시키거나 축소시킬 수 있습니다. 이는 기업이 더욱 효율적으로 운영할 수 있도록 도와줍니다.

또한 클라우드 컴퓨팅은 혁신적인 기술을 개발하고 새로운 서비스를 제공하는 데 큰 역할을 합니다. 클라우드 컴퓨팅을 통해 기업은 더 빠르게 시장 변화에 대응하고 경쟁력을 유지할 수 있습니다. 또한 클라우드 컴퓨팅은 데이터를 실시간으로 분석하고 가치 있는 정보를 도출하는 데도 큰 도움을 줍니다.

최근에는 인공 지능과 빅데이터 분석과 같은 기술이 클라우드 컴퓨팅과 결합되어 더욱 강력한 서비스를 제공하고 있습니다. 클라우드 컴퓨팅은 미래의 기술 발전을 이끌어가는 중요한 역할을 하고 있으며, 계속해서 발전해 나가야 할 분야 중 하나입니다.

시스템 아키텍처

시스템 아키텍처는 소프트웨어 및 하드웨어 구성 요소 간의 상호 작용 방식을 결정하는 중요한 요소입니다. 이는 시스템이 어떻게 작동하고 서로 통신하는지에 대한 체계적인 계획을 제공합니다. 시스템 아키텍처는 전체적인 시스템의 설계와 구현에 대한 방향을 제시하며, 시스템의 안정성, 확장성, 보안성 및 성능을 보장하기 위한 중요한 역할을 합니다.

시스템 아키텍처는 각 구성 요소 간의 관계와 역할을 명확히 정의하고, 시스템의 기능과 특성을 이해하는 데 도움을 줍니다. 또한, 시스템의 요구 사항을 충족시키기 위해 필요한 기술과 리소스를 식별하고 할당하는 데 중요한 역할을 합니다. 이를 통해 개발자와 시스템 운영자는 시스템을 효율적으로 관리하고 유지보수할 수 있습니다.

시스템 아키텍처는 시스템의 전체적인 성능을 최적화하기 위해 필요한 요소들을 고려하여 설계되어야 합니다. 이는 시스템의 확장성과 유연성을 보장하고, 새로운 요구 사항이나 기술 변화에 대응할 수 있는 기반이 마련됩니다. 또한, 시스템 아키텍처는 시스템의 보안을 강화하고 잠재적인 위협으로부터 시스템을 보호하는 데 필요한 구성 요소를 제공합니다.

시스템 아키텍처는 시스템의 전체적인 효율성과 안정성을 보장하기 위해 중요한 역할을 합니다. 따라서, 시스템을 설계하고 구현할 때 시스템 아키텍처에 대한 신중한 고려가 필요합니다. 이를 통해 안정적이고 효율적인 시스템을 구축할 수 있으며, 사용자들에게 더 나은 서비스를 제공할 수 있습니다.

INTERACTIVE CONCEPT

Leave a Comment